Reporting to the Board of Directors, the CEO will take a proactive approach to develop the organization's profile and prominence within the sports industry. The CEO will be responsible for the managing the organization’s financials, human resources, interactions with the Board and its Committees, and day to day running of Singapore Gymnastics operations. Together with the Performance Director (PD), the CEO will develop the organisation’s profile and prominence within the sports industry and develop strategies to diversify revenue streams and promote the sport to attract sponsors. All this should be done in alignment with the Singapore Gymnastics Business Plan FY26-29. The CEO needs to demonstrate the ability to think and plan strategically as well as managing the day-to-day operation of a growing organization. Responsibilities Leadership Establish with the PD and BoD the vision, mission and values of SG with a focus on creating value for the Members. Develop in consultation with the PD, and recommend to the BoD for adoption, a Business Plan consistent with the vision, mission and values of SG. Identify opportunities which are consistent with the vision, mission, values and Business Plan of SG. Set the tone for SG to promote and foster an ethical and responsible culture that supports the attainment of SG’s aims and objectives; and Provide the executive leadership necessary to guide and inspire the staff of SG to ensure the long‑term success. Board of Directors Work collaboratively with the Board of Directors (BoD) to establish sound governance and accountability systems and processes. Work closely with the President, Secretary and Treasurer, and the chairs of each board committee to: bring decisions to be made by the board and board committees and other matters of importance to the board's and board committees' attention in a timely manner; and set board, board committee agendas, and provide timely and relevant information to the board and board committees to enable the board and board committees to effectively discharge their obligations. Provide support for BoD activities. Prepare the Annual Report for presentation at the Annual General Meeting. Set up and monitor the effectiveness of communication channels to ensure that the BoD, Committees, staff and members are kept informed of activities. Finance Oversee the overall budget for Singapore Gymnastics in collaboration with Finance and HR Manager (FHM). Ensure that individual budgets for each programme are submitted and coordinated.
